This setting, found within the "Advanced" tab of your Wi-Fi adapter's driver properties on Windows, isn't just a simple on/off switch. It is a core part of a broader "adaptivity" suite (also including EnableAdaptivity and HLDiffForAdaptivity ) designed to help your connection dynamically adjust to interference, signal noise, and network congestion. While most users will have it set to "Auto" by default, manually selecting a specific value can be the key to unlocking performance or stability.
